It is the one made for the GS.

The thing about the TRS is, no matter what bike they say they are for, they are all the same external length and size internally. I just bought a full set of matching TRS with pipes for a Busa. They came in today and they are the same as what is on the GS5.

How they mount is the difference and although the one of my bike now has the slip-on for the stick GS5 exhaust, the other one that was for a GSXR can be made to fit with very little effort.
